Medical Services of America, Inc. (MSA) was founded in 1973 and has grown to become one of the nation’s leading privately-owned home healthcare providers. MSA began with a unique concept to become a “Total Home Health Care Provider” and the company’s expansion has been guided with that concept in mind. MSA Healthcare currently offers home health, hospice, home medical equipment, and assisted living with individual offices/agencies located across 13 states: Florida, Georgia, Indiana, Kentucky, Maryland, North Carolina, Ohio,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ee, Virginia and West Virginia. It is our mission to provide high-quality, comprehensive home healthcare services that support longevity in the patient’s home environment.
